A novel off-line anonymous and divisible digital cash protocol utilizing smart card for mobile payment

A novel off-line anonymous digital cash protocol utilizing smart card is presented in this paper. It employs smart card as a distributed anonymity and divisibility provider agent based on Schnorr signature scheme. It provides accountable anonymity and divisibility. Its digital …
